WLAN 1010 and WLAN 2010 Compact wireless module for external antennas

The WLAN 1010 and WLAN 2010 wireless modules are particularly compact. With their external antenna connections, they are perfectly suited for complex wireless tasks where it is necessary for the antenna positioning to be flexible. Moreover, they also feature the proven high reliability of the 1000 and 2000 series. They also feature robust, industrial housings, reliable MIMO wireless technology, and comprehensive software functions that can be configured over a wide range of interfaces such as web, SNMP, REST API, and CLI.

WLAN 1010 – fits into compact machines

Vehicles, warehouse shuttles, and machines should be small. Many designs face the same issue: Lack of space. All of the components therefore must be compact and flexible in mounting. The WLAN 1010 series was developed to address exactly this. The compact WLAN module can be mounted on walls and panels, or latched easily onto a DIN rail. The metal base plate ensures a secure attachment and reliable heat dissipation.

Your advantage: The device can be mounted anywhere.

Connection for external antennas

The right antenna solution is key for a reliable wireless connection. To ensure good wireless coverage around a vehicle, you sometimes have to mount antennas on different sides of the vehicle. The FL WLAN 1010 is equipped with two antenna connections precisely for these cases. You therefore always have the optimum antenna solution.

Particularly secure with security standards and user profiles

High security with two virtual access points and IP filters

Protecting your network and your data against misuse and manipulation is important to us. The WLAN 1010 supports the latest WLAN security standards, such as WPA-AES encryption and RADIUS authentication. Furthermore, different WLAN access points can be set up for two different user groups, e.g., service staff and operators, each with their own password and access filters. Thus, for example, service staff have unlimited WLAN access to all devices in the network, while operators can only access the visualization server.

Easy to control via the PLC – via REST API

The WLAN 1010 can be configured easily and controlled for runtime via a REST API using a PC or PLC. Several WLAN 1010 modules can therefore be configured quickly and easily with one command. Furthermore, network administration tasks can be automated via the controller, such as in order to assign a new single-use WLAN password to WLAN users for each connection. This is a simple solution to the security risk arising through use of shared, static WLAN passwords.

WLAN Mesh for automation networks

With the new WLAN Mesh operating mode of the FL WLAN 2010 wireless modules, WLAN networks are easy to establish and ranges in existing WLAN networks can be increased. By using numerous mesh access points, you can cover larger areas without having to lay cables. The WLAN Mesh function is also available on older WLAN 2010 modules by updating the firmware.
